Shares of Mandhana slumped 5 percent intraday on Wednesday after Being Human brand ambassador Salman Khan has been pronounced guilty by a Mumbai Sessions Court of all charges in the 2002 hit-and-run case. The Bollywood actor has been sentenced to 5-year imprisonment for culpable homicide not amounting to murder. He was convicted for ramming his car, while drunk, into a roadside bakery at suburban Bandra in the early hours of September 28, 2002, killing one person and injuring four others.

Mandhana Industries has an exclusive licence agreement with Being Human- the Salman Khan Foundation - for designing, marketing and distributing Being Human Clothing.

Meanwhile, Eros International Media fell 7 percent as it had acquired global distribution rights of Salman Khan’s two upcoming movies - Bajrangi Bhaijaan and Hero. Bajrangi Bhaijaan, slated for an Eid release in July 2015, also stars Kareena Kapoor and Nawazuddin Siddiqui. Bajrangi Bhaijaan is produced by Salman Khan and Rockline Venkatesh Films.

Hero is a co-production with Mukta Arts, and is a modern day adaptation of Subhash Ghai's classic of the same name being directed by Nikhil Advani. The superstar endorses 10 brands ranging from cola drinks to motorcycles and has huge money riding on him.

At 13:50 hrs Mandhana Industries was at Rs 264.80, down Rs 11.40, or 4.13 percent while Eros International Media was at Rs 388.65, down Rs 15.25, or 3.78 percent on the BSE.
